Web22 jun. 2024 · Renters insurance has three basic coverage components: personal possessions, liability, and additional living expenses. Personal Possessions This … WebIntroduction. Liability insurance for renters is a type of coverage that protects tenants from financial liability if they accidentally cause damage to their rental unit or someone else’s property. This coverage can also protect against legal fees and medical expenses in the event that someone is injured on the rented property.
